Trip Overview

The drive from Marshall, OK to Coyle, OK covers 35.6 miles and takes about 48m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.

The route leans on 42nd "Rainbow" Infantry Division Memorial Highway, South Coyle Road, Angie Debo Memorial Highway for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is turn-heavy local dr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 20.1 miles on 42nd "Rainbow" Infantry Division Memorial Highway. At current regular gas prices, budget about $5.57 one way before food or hotel costs.
